Study on TEMPO-Mediated Selective Oxidation of Alkaline Natural Cellulose Pulp and Properties of Its Products

Abstract:It has been reported that natural cellulose(celluloseⅠ) can not be oxidized by TEMPO - NaOCl -NaBr system, one of TEMPO-mediated selective oxidantsystems, but regenerated cellulose(cellulose Ⅰ)can becompletely selectively oxidized. In the present work,natural cellulose pulp was treated with NaOH solution,which concentration is lower than 20 wt%. The alkalinecelluloses obtained were oxidized by TEMPO - NaOCl -NaBr system and the factors which influence the selectiveoxidation reaction rate have been investigated. Thestructure of the oxidized products has been characterizedby Fourier transform-infrared(FTIR), nuclear magenaticresonace(NMR) and wide angle X-ray diffraction(WAXD) methods, and their adsorption properties forCu2 and Cd2 in aqueous solutions have beenpreliminarily examined. The results show that after thealkaline treatment, the primary hydroxyl at C6 position ofnatural cellulose can be selectively oxidized to carboxylgroup in the reaction medium at pH 10.8, the oxidationrate becomes greater with the NaOH concentration andalkaline treatment time increasing. The alkaline treatmenthas a great effect on the crystal structure of naturalcellulose, but the crystal structure of alkaline cellulosekeeps almost unchanged after oxidation. The adsorptioncapacity is enhanced by introducing carboxyl groups intothe cellulose macromolecular chains.
